Table 5-6: Nebraska and U.S. Recreational Boat Registrations by Propulsion Type

Excel | CSV

  Nebraska United States
1999 2000 1999 2000
Total 72,153 73,638 12,738,271 12,782,143
Powered 70,269 71,406 11,811,562 11,648,769
Nonpowered 1,198 1,214 481,191 547,271
Other 686 1,018 445,518 590,103

NOTE: Powered includes inboard, outboard, stern drive, auxiliary sail, and PWC; nonpowered includes rowboat, canoe or kayak, and sail only.

NOTES FOR DATA ON THIS PAGE: U.S. totals include Guam, Puerto Rico, the Virgin Islands, American Samoa, and the Northern Mariana Islands. Nebraska statistics include all watercraft. U.S. total does not include sailboards, which are numbered in some states.

SOURCES FOR DATA ON THIS PAGE: U.S. Department of Transportation, U.S. Coast Guard, Boating Statistics, 2000 and Boating Statistics, 1999, Washington, DC: 2001,available at www.uscgboating.org/Saf/pdf/Boating_Statistics_2000.pdf and 1999.pdf as of Nov. 14, 2001.
